21 #define SECTOR_SHIFT		9
22 #define SECTOR_SIZE		(1UL << SECTOR_SHIFT)
23 
24 enum {
25 	DISK_IMAGE_REGULAR,
26 	DISK_IMAGE_MMAP,
27 };
28 
29 #define MAX_DISK_IMAGES         4
30 
31 struct disk_image;
32 
33 struct disk_image_operations {
34 	ssize_t (*read)(struct disk_image *disk, u64 sector, const struct iovec *iov,
35 			int iovcount, void *param);
36 	ssize_t (*write)(struct disk_image *disk, u64 sector, const struct iovec *iov,
37 			int iovcount, void *param);
38 	int (*flush)(struct disk_image *disk);
39 	int (*close)(struct disk_image *disk);
40 };
41 
42 struct disk_image_params {
43 	const char *filename;
44 	/*
45 	 * wwpn == World Wide Port Number
46 	 * tpgt == Target Portal Group Tag
47 	 */
48 	const char *wwpn;
49 	const char *tpgt;
50 	bool readonly;
51 	bool direct;
52 };
53 
54 struct disk_image {
55 	int				fd;
56 	u64				size;
57 	struct disk_image_operations	*ops;
58 	void				*priv;
59 	void				*disk_req_cb_param;
60 	void				(*disk_req_cb)(void *param, long len);
61 	bool				async;
62 	int				evt;
63 #ifdef CONFIG_HAS_AIO
64 	io_context_t			ctx;
65 #endif
66 	const char			*wwpn;
67 	const char			*tpgt;
68 };
69 
70 struct disk_image *disk_image__open(const char *filename, bool readonly, bool direct);
71 struct disk_image **disk_image__open_all(struct disk_image_params *params, int count);
72 struct disk_image *disk_image__new(int fd, u64 size, struct disk_image_operations *ops, int mmap);
73 int disk_image__close(struct disk_image *disk);
74 int disk_image__close_all(struct disk_image **disks, int count);
75 int disk_image__flush(struct disk_image *disk);
76 ssize_t disk_image__read(struct disk_image *disk, u64 sector, const struct iovec *iov,
77 				int iovcount, void *param);
78 ssize_t disk_image__write(struct disk_image *disk, u64 sector, const struct iovec *iov,
79 				int iovcount, void *param);
80 ssize_t disk_image__get_serial(struct disk_image *disk, void *buffer, ssize_t *len);
